and with the video game Harry Potter: Quidditch Champions releasing in the Muggle world, its popularity is once again surging ...
Welcome to the wizarding world of collegiate-level quidditch, where the fantasy game found in Harry Potter books and movies has made its way to Brandeis’s enchanted campus. If you’re a Muggle like me ...